Kinda hard to explain, but here goes nothing.
If you were to move a window on your screen, the window will drag in real time with your holding the mouse down. I can drag the screen but I can't tell where the screen will end up until I let go of the mouse.
If you go to resize a window, you're window will constantly adjust in real time (and you can see it with your eyes) with you moving the mouse. Or there will be a black border that shows you just how you are adjusting the screen size. When I want to resize a window I don't know exactly the new window size will look until I release the mouse. This is a new problem on my surface pro 4 with windows 10 and hasn't been an issue before, wondering if there's some checkbox in the settings somewhere that I clicked or something.
